HERNANDEZ, Danmarys et al. Diseño de un sistema de PCR para la detección del virus del papiloma humano mediante el uso de oligonucleótidos degenerados de la región E6. Rev Obstet Ginecol Venez [online]. 2012, vol.72, n.4, pp.249-254. ISSN 0048-7732.
Objective: Design and standardize a PCR system to detect a broad spectrum of HPV types in a single reaction using target the E6 region of the viral genome. Methods: Using E6 gene sequences of different HPV types and NCBI tools Mult Alin Oligo Analyzer version 1.1.2 5.4.1. Degenerate oligonucleotides were designed that allowed amplification of a fragment of approximately 214 bp. Selected samples include: 25 DNA samples, each positive for a single HPV type typified by PCR-RFLP system MY11/MY09 L1 gene. Results: We obtained approximately 214 bp amplified from 25 different HPV types were detected in samples amplified from E6 negative MY09/MY11 system. Conclusions: It was determined that the design of degenerate oligonucleotides was highly efficient for amplification of at least 25 different HPV types which would facilitate detection in clinical samples.
Palabras clave : HPV; E6 gene; PCR; MY09/MY11.
